Vonage My WRTP54G is 3 years old. I purchased it to subcribe to Vonage. Three days ago,



My WRTP54G is 3 years old. I purchased it to subcribe to Vonage. Three days ago, the router started rebooting every minute or so. I called support and they told me that the router was out of warranty, go buy a new one and they would give me a $40 credit towards the purchase.

Three months ago, we changed ISP's to Verizon FiOS. A new wireless router came with the bundle. I place the new router side by side with the Linksys router and tested both router's WIFI using different channels. Both worked fine. The Actiontec MI-424-WR FiOS WIFI router has a very powerful transmitter that beats the Linksys router.

I tested the power pack for the WRTP54G and it read 12.1 volts DC: good. I opened the WRTP54G and examined for burned out components and found none.

I noticed that the Linksys router would reboot within seconds of the WIFI light coming on. I also noticed that there is a separate WIFI daughter board inserted in a slot on the main board. Could the WIFI board be defective?

I removed the WIFI board and repowered the router. The router did not reboot and appeared to be stable. I then placed it near the FiOS router and attached the power cord, phone line and "WAN cable" to the FiOS router. The Linksys router did not complain. I took the phone off hook and had dial tone. I dialed my home phone from a cell phone and it worked!

I believe that the Actiontec WIFI transmitter's intense signal burned out the weaker Linksys WIFI circuitry because I placed them side by side with both antennas only inches away from each other. Lesson learned!

I am leaving the WIFI card out of the WRTP54G as I don't need it, but I do need the router as a basic Vonage phone adapter and will only use it as such from now on.

It's not worth laying out any money for a replacement and repairs are impossible. If it dies completely, I'll go with a plain old no-frills Voip phone adapter.

Don't be afraid to open your WRTP54G router up to remove the WIFI card to see if this fixes your "constantly rebooting" problem. You're only dealing with 12 volts DC at a very low amperage.
